http://www.theinventors.org/library/weekly/aa092998.htm WebFinally in November of 1971 Intel publicly introduced the world's first single chip microprocessor called the Intel 4004. It was invented by Intel engineers Ted Hoff, Federico Faggin, and Stan Mazor. The Intel 4004 was smaller than a thumbnail, packed 2,300 transistors, executed 60,000 operations a second, and sold for $200 at the time.

WebMar 26, 2024 · Also in 1971 Intel engineers Ted Hoff, Federico Faggin, and Stan Mazor invented a general-purpose four-bit microprocessor and one of the first single-chip microprocessors, the 4004, under contract to the Japanese calculator manufacturer Nippon Calculating Machine Corporation, which let Intel retain all rights to the technology.
